We're building the credit defense tool we wished existed.
Just Dispute IT exists because the credit-repair industry is broken. Predatory companies charge $99–$200/month for letters anyone can write for free under the Fair Credit Reporting Act. We're replacing that with software that respects you, costs almost nothing, and keeps you in control.

The FCRA is on your side.
Federal law gives you the right to dispute inaccuracies and demand verification. Most people just don't know it. We make it easy.
